Mom's Dating Made Me a Millionaire!

She never expected that her mom would use her photos to start online romances. Then, a bunch of handsome guys start showing up at her door. She unexpectedly gets a system. Any wild story her mom made up becomes real as long as she agrees to it! New skills unlock. She also meets a CEO. But things are getting more complicated...
